| 用法说明 | ‘Convention’ 用于正式的聚会,尤其是在商业、政治或特定兴趣领域。避免在非正式场合使用。Use 'convention' for formal gatherings, especially in business, politics, or specific areas of interest. Avoid using it in casual contexts. | 常用于社交活动和会议。既可用于非正式场合,也可用于正式场合,但在非常正式的场合(如官方商务会议)应避免使用。Commonly used for social events and meetings. Suitable in both casual and formal contexts, but avoid in very formal settings like official business meetings. |
